Low Noise Silicon Bipolar RF Transistor • For ESD protected high gain low noise amplifier • Excellent ESD performance typical value 1000 V (HBM) • Outstanding Gms = 20 dB Minimum noise figure NFmin = 0.
9 dB • Pb-free (ROHS compliant) and halogen-free thin small flat package with visible leads • Qualification report according to AEC-Q101 available BFP540FESD 3 2 4 1 ESD (Electrostatic discharge) sensitive device, observe handling precaution!
